Since 2013, Sara has been the owner of a vintage clothing store in Bushwick called Chess and the Sphinx. She sourced vintage clothing by attending estate sales and offering private closet cleaning. Many of the homes she worked in were being prepared to go to market, and many of the women who are beginning to sell their clothing are in the process of downsizing their homes. The idea of obtaining her real estate license and working with Elegran was a natural progression for her.
Raised in Westchester, New York, Sara makes her home in Brooklyn, on the border of Bushwick and Ridgewood. She attended The School of the Art Institute of Chicago, and received a BA in Painting with an Emphasis in Art History.
